Yung Pueblo and the Revolution Within

Yung Pueblo (Diego Perez) is a writer and meditation practitioner known for his insightful approach to self-love and inner peace. In this conversation, he discusses the power of meditation in overcoming mental health challenges and the importance of embracing impermanence. He shares experiences from silent retreats and emphasizes that personal healing can lead to societal change. Diego also explores the themes of his new book, How to Love Better, urging listeners to cultivate kindness and compassion as essential tools for creating a brighter future.

Mark Ruffalo on the Future of Humanity (Pt. 1)

Mark Ruffalo, award-nominated actor and climate justice advocate, dives deep into America's compassion crisis. He shares poignant reflections on losing his brother to gun violence and the urgent need to combat political violence with empathy. Mark advocates for recognizing our opponents as human beings, highlighting the role of frontline communities in climate activism through The Solutions Project. He discusses the importance of reframing disagreement and fostering compassion in these polarized times, ultimately envisioning a united, just future.

Eat, Pray, Toxic Love Addict w/ Elizabeth Gilbert

In this episode, bestselling author Elizabeth Gilbert, known for "Eat, Pray, Love," delves into her journey through love addiction and grief. She shares poignant insights on heartbreak's similarities to substance abuse and discusses the concept of life as "Earth School" for spiritual growth. Elizabeth candidly reveals her own struggles with codependency and addiction while reflecting on her relationship with Raya, including the profound lessons learned in love and honesty. The conversation promotes the healing power of unconditional love and the importance of setting boundaries.

Escaping a Cult (w/ Chess Master Danny Rensch)

In this engaging conversation, Danny Rensch, a chess master and key figure in the online chess world, shares his powerful journey from growing up in the Church of Immortal Consciousness to building Chess.com. He candidly discusses the challenges of escaping a cult, the painful separation from his mother, and his path to healing. Danny also explores the resilience required to overcome spiritual manipulation and the importance of forgiveness in rebuilding life’s meaning after trauma.

God Told Lil Rel to 'Get Out'

Comedian Lil Rel Howery, known for his breakout role in 'Get Out,' opens up about overcoming grief and panic attacks following his mother's death. He shares a prophetic vision that foreshadowed his success and discusses how the Black church shaped his spiritual journey. Lil Rel emphasizes the healing power of stand-up comedy, likening it to medicine. The conversation also touches on the cultural impact of 'Get Out' and the need for comedy to be taken as seriously as drama in the entertainment industry.

The Daily Stoic's Guide to Spirituality (w/ Ryan Holiday)

Ryan Holiday, a prominent author known for his insights into Stoicism, joins Rainn Wilson to delve into the intersection of Stoicism and spirituality. They discuss how ancient practices provide modern solutions for anxiety and purpose. Highlighting themes of resilience and personal growth, they explore the transformative journey toward deeper virtues. The conversation also emphasizes the importance of journaling, radical acceptance, and the relevance of Stoicism in today’s complex world, making ancient wisdom accessible for younger generations.

Finding God Within: Sri M Explores Consciousness

Sri M, a Himalayan spiritual teacher and social reformer, dives deep into the realms of consciousness and the soul with Rainn Wilson. They discuss the connection between spirituality and service, emphasizing love and peace as core values across all traditions. Sri M reflects on the dilution of original spiritual experiences in organized religion and shares personal stories of transformation. He advocates for integrating spirituality into daily life while navigating modern challenges, promoting kindness and the importance of community in fostering mental well-being.

Adam Grant Breaks the Confidence Myth

Adam Grant, a NYT bestselling author and organizational psychologist, dives deep into the myths surrounding confidence. He discusses how failure and perfectionism can mislead our perception of self-worth and emphasizes that passion isn’t something to find but rather to cultivate. Grant also reflects on generational shifts in mental health views and workplace expectations. Highlighting the power of reframing narratives, he encourages a more authentic approach to life, revealing that true motivation may come from a surprising source—serving others.

Finding God in a Panic Attack w/ Victoria Hutchins

Victoria Hutchins, a former lawyer turned poet and yoga teacher, shares her journey of religious deconstruction and finding joy in everyday life. She discusses overcoming anxiety and burnout through the transformative power of poetry and yoga. Victoria reads her poignant poems and reflects on the interplay of pain and joy, exploring how social media has shaped modern spirituality. She emphasizes the importance of childlike wonder and small joys while navigating a spiritual crisis, revealing insights on faith and personal growth.

Ed Helms and the Good Old Days

Ed Helms, actor and comedian from The Office and The Hangover, discusses the nuances of memory and living in the moment. He reflects on the emotional impact of a single line from The Office finale and shares his ADHD diagnosis and journey with therapy. The conversation also touches on the pitfalls of social media, the importance of vulnerability, and the healing power of self-compassion. Ed reveals insights from his new book and podcast, SNAFU, exploring historical screw-ups and how they mirror personal growth.
